How much can you earn on Airbnb in Pero, Lombardy? Based on AirROI's 2026 dataset (April 2025 – March 2026), the short answer is $16,283 per year — at a $168 nightly rate, 33.1% occupancy, and a $56 RevPAR that reflects a wider gap between nightly rates and realized revenue that rewards occupancy-focused strategies.

At 71 active listings, Pero is a boutique market where selective demand that rewards strong listing quality and pricing strategy. Supply grew 61.4% over the past year, yet revenue and nightly rates both trended upward — a signal that traveler demand is outpacing new inventory rather than being diluted by it. For hosts, pricing power remains intact even as competition increases.

Regulation is high and 90% of listings show active registration — compliance is the cost of entry. In a market this size, differentiated listings with strong reviews can capture outsized returns relative to the competition.

How Much Do Airbnb Hosts Earn Monthly in Pero?

Understanding the monthly revenue variations for Airbnb listings in Pero is key to maximizing your short term rental income potential. Seasonality significantly impacts earnings. Our analysis, based on data from the past 12 months, shows that the peak revenue month for STRs in Pero is typically February, while June often presents the lowest earnings, highlighting opportunities for strategic pricing adjustments during shoulder and low seasons. Explore the typical Airbnb income in Pero across different performance tiers:

  • Best-in-class properties (Top 10%) achieve $3,625+ monthly, often utilizing dynamic pricing and superior guest experiences.
  • Strong performing properties (Top 25%) earn $2,479 or more, indicating effective management and desirable locations/amenities.
  • Typical properties (Median) generate around $1,518 per month, representing the average market performance.
  • Entry-level properties (Bottom 25%) see earnings around $814, often with potential for optimization.

When Is the Peak Season for Airbnb in Pero?

Pero's peak Airbnb season falls in February, April, December, while the softest stretch is June, July, August. Overall, the market shows highly seasonal trends requiring careful strategy, which should guide pricing, minimum stays, and cash-flow planning.

Peak Season (February, April, December)
  • Revenue averages $2,461 per month
  • Occupancy rates average 41.1%
  • Daily rates average $185
Shoulder Season
  • Revenue averages $1,745 per month
  • Occupancy maintains around 35.3%
  • Daily rates hold near $164
Low Season (June, July, August)
  • Revenue drops to average $1,386 per month
  • Occupancy decreases to average 30.9%
  • Daily rates adjust to average $153

Seasonality Insights for Pero

  • Airbnb seasonality in Pero is pronounced. Revenue swings sharply between peak and low months, which means pricing strategy, minimum-stay settings, and cash reserves all need to account for extended slower periods.
  • During the high season, the absolute peak month showcases Pero's highest earning potential, with monthly revenues climbing to $3,018, occupancy reaching 45.2%, and ADRs peaking at $214.
  • Conversely, the slowest single month marks the market's lowest point — revenue may dip to $1,250, occupancy could drop to 27.6%, and ADRs may adjust to $148.
  • Lower occupancy paired with meaningful seasonality means hosts in Pero need to maximize every peak-season booking and seriously consider whether off-season pricing adjustments or minimum-stay changes can capture incremental revenue.

How Much Are Airbnb Cleaning Fees in Pero?

Cleaning fees in Pero are meaningful operating levers, not just pass-through charges. What matters most is how often hosts charge them, how high they run relative to market norms, and how large a share of gross revenue they consume.

Average Cleaning Fee
$65
Median Cleaning Fee
$44
Listings Charging a Fee
62.0%
Fee as Revenue Share
7.7%

Cleaning Fee Insights for Pero

  • About 62.0% of Pero listings charge a cleaning fee — a mixed market where some hosts absorb the cost into nightly rates while others break it out.
  • The gap between the average ($65) and median ($44) cleaning fee indicates some high-end properties are pulling the average up considerably.
  • Cleaning fees represent 7.7% of gross revenue on average — a modest component of the overall booking price.
